/* HAX exit status */
 | 
						|
enum exit_status {
 | 
						|
    /* IO port request */
 | 
						|
    HAX_EXIT_IO = 1,
 | 
						|
    /* MMIO instruction emulation */
 | 
						|
    HAX_EXIT_MMIO,
 | 
						|
    /* QEMU emulation mode request, currently means guest enter non-PG mode */
 | 
						|
    HAX_EXIT_REAL,
 | 
						|
    /*
 | 
						|
     * Interrupt window open, qemu can inject interrupt now
 | 
						|
     * Also used when signal pending since at that time qemu usually need
 | 
						|
     * check interrupt
 | 
						|
     */
 | 
						|
    HAX_EXIT_INTERRUPT,
 | 
						|
    /* Unknown vmexit, mostly trigger reboot */
 | 
						|
    HAX_EXIT_UNKNOWN_VMEXIT,
 | 
						|
    /* HALT from guest */
 | 
						|
    HAX_EXIT_HLT,
 | 
						|
    /* Reboot request, like because of tripple fault in guest */
 | 
						|
    HAX_EXIT_STATECHANGE,
 | 
						|
    /* the vcpu is now only paused when destroy, so simply return to hax */
 | 
						|
    HAX_EXIT_PAUSED,
 | 
						|
    HAX_EXIT_FAST_MMIO,
 | 
						|
};
